Transaction e89ec00bdc1eff9dbf4f24c594cf9810a5d633487ed745868c84f951cbc82f7a
1 Input
1 Output
-
e89ec00bdc1eff9dbf4f24c594cf9810a5d633487ed745868c84f951cbc82f7a:0
- value
- 19948533
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 077e5d53aa578b8fe4c953418cd4d607cb3c3fd2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1gd7Jm7ke3TYJcV3mgq2yFawWCPdrHZCH